Java语言基础学习第二季视频教程

¥50.00 试听
 相关套餐
Java Web开发工程师从零基础到就业完整学习路线图

 14套课程   264节课时

¥1332.00¥2655.005折

 学院:新趋势IT教育

 课时:共 12节 · 4小时3分钟

 有效期:永久有效

 适合人群:Java入门

 课程介绍

一、学习方法:
1、本课程需要有面向对象的基础知识,如果没有基础基础知识,请先观看学习“听强哥说Java”的第一部。
2、绝不可以只看不练,那样是可能学会的。
3、知识要有系统性,切记看的太杂,贪多嚼不烂。
4、独创的课程体系,最大程度降低学习难度,可以用最快的速度学会Java很多学起来很难,但是对就业帮助不大的内容,包括a.线程 b.swing c.流 d.套接字 放在后面需要的地方来讲。

二、枚举
enum 表示可以计数的一种类型。
计算数目
性别    星期几...


String.Format格式化字符串

Java基础第二季视频教程

2.类的静态成员
static =静态
该成员属于整个类,而不属于某个对象
实例成员 属于类的每个实例

三、异常
1.通过一个简单的例子演示一下异常
字符串转换成整数
2.什么是异常
程序运行中出现的,导致程序无法正常运行的错误,叫做异常

 

异常的父类Throwable
Error (一般是Jvm运行中出现了问题,不用处理,也没法处理)

Exception
分为两种,其中一种叫做RuntimeException,这种错误可以处理,也可以不处理。、
零外一种叫做得RuntimeException。

演示类的继承关系图
RuntimeException
1.NullPointerException(空指针异常)
2.IndexOutOfBoundsException(数组下标越界异常) ArrayIndexOutOfBoundsExption
3.NumberFormatException(数据格式异常)
4.ClassCastException(类型转换异常)
5.IllegalArgumentException(非法参数异常)
6.ArtihmeticException(算术异常)
7.IllegalStateExcption(非法语句异常)
非RuntimeException
ClassNotFountException(类找不到异常)

 

JAVA Exception

 

四、抛出异常与处理异常
try catch finally
以及多个catch块的情况

五、反射
什么叫反射?
   通过类名活动
  Class.forName("");
  案例:动态创建对象,调用对象的方法
  通过反射还可以做到
a.获得这个类实现了那些接口
  getInterFaces
b.得到其父类
  getSuperclass
c.得到所有的构造函数
  getCostructors
更多详细的可以参考资料:
(ps:观看视频可以查看)

 

java reflection

 

六、集合框架
集合:用来存放很多元素的一种类型。
框架:结构体系,很多类组成。

java Collection Framework=Java 集合框架

七、数组和集合的关系
数组定长,只能存同一种类型 Type mismatch:cannot convert form Test to String

容器 体系 集合框架

JAVA API(Application Programming Tnerface=应用程序接口)
Java 1.8 =Java 8
collection 老祖先,接口(interface)

 

集合框架体系图

 

八、 List
ArrayList,LinkeList,Vector

九、 Set
hashSet,TreeSet
数据存储方式不一样,称为不要的数据结构
分析Collection中的方法
举个例子:Animal Person,增删改查。

十、Map接口及其实现类

java map 继承与实现

  本课程的目的是让有基础的学员们进一步学习Java语言,以简单轻松的讲课方式,让大家投入到学习中去,为将来的工作打好基础。

课程评价

难得糊涂

2022-07-04
实用性很强,互动性强,简单易懂,老师讲的很好。

121***4

2018-09-17
简单易懂,互动性强,老师讲的很好。

课课家教育

未登录